We are seeking a talented and motivated Software Engineer to join our dynamic team. The ideal candidate will have a strong foundation in software development and a passion for creating innovative solutions. This role involves working on various projects that require proficiency in multiple programming languages and technologies, including MySQL, Java, JavaScript, Ruby on Rails, and AWS. You will collaborate with cross-functional teams to design, develop, and maintain high-quality software applications.
Responsibilities
Write, modify, integrate and test software code
Maintain existing computer programs by making modifications as required
Communicate technical problems, processes and solutions
Prepare reports, manuals and other documentation on the status, operation and maintenance of software
Assist in the collection and documentation of user's requirements
Assist in the development of logical and physical specifications
Research and evaluate a variety of software products
Program animation software to predefined specifications for interactive CDs, DVDs, video game cartridges and Internet-based applications
Program special effects software for film and video applications
Write, modify, integrate and test software code for e-commerce and other Internet applications
Consult with clients after sale to provide ongoing support
Qualifications
Bachelor's degree in Computer Science or related field, or equivalent experience.
Proficiency in programming languages such as Java, Ruby on Rails, JavaScript, and VBA.
Experience with web development frameworks and RESTful API design.
Familiarity with cloud services such as AWS is a plus.
Strong understanding of database management systems like MySQL.
Excellent problem-solving skills and attention to detail.
Ability to work collaboratively in a team environment while also being self-motivated.
Strong communication skills to effectively convey technical concepts to non-technical stakeholders.
Join us in building innovative software solutions that make a difference!
Job Type: Full-time
Pay: $45.00-$60.00 per hour
Expected hours: 30 - 40 per week
Language:
English (preferred)
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.